Curiously, with the somewhat-ancient Kenmore refer here, that's the ~first~ thing it does after a power interruption, run a defrost cycle. I have to remember yank the cord out of the wall before I transfer my loads over the the Outback inverter so I can manage everything into an even keel before letting it have some energy to play with. I prefer to bring the backup power online, check for unexpected consumption (maybe I didn't remember to shut off all the household loads before throwing the transfer switch, don't need to be running a space heater in the bathroom on the inverter...), bring the hydro plant back online and check various meter readings, etc. Then it's time to get the dump load controller running so the excess power over what it takes to run the house can go into the water heater. Having the refer gobble power during this transfer process is counteractive to starting up smoothly.
The cumulative sum of my energy input sources is such that the batteries are only necessary for load leveling/motor starting, etc, and I can go for days on end without input from the utility.
